SkillSpector: 1 finding, up to medium
These are SkillSpector’s own severities. On a checked sample its high-severity flags on skills were ~96% false positives — a documented command, a public API, a “never do X” rule — so we show them as a caution to read, not a verdict. Why →
- medium Excessive Agency · line 4 Skill selects an external model or provider that may use a different account or billing plan than the operator expects. Undisclosed model switches can cause unexpected cost or quota consumption.Fix: Remove the model/provider override or disclose it prominently and require explicit operator approval before invoking an external coding CLI or billed model.
What it costs to keep this loaded
Counted locally with the o200k_base tokenizer, which is exact for GPT models; Claude uses its own tokenizer and its counts differ. Treat this as one consistent yardstick across the catalogue rather than a bill. Prices are per million input tokens.
| Model | Per session | Once invoked |
|---|---|---|
| Fable 5.1 | $0.00060 | $0.01296 |
| Opus 5 | $0.00030 | $0.00648 |
| Sonnet 5 | $0.00012 | $0.00259 |
| Haiku 4.5 | $0.00006 | $0.00130 |
Grade A, and why
ag-implementar-codigo scanned grade A with 0 findings against 26 rules in 11 categories — prompt injection, anti-refusal, data exfiltration, privilege escalation, supply chain, agent snooping, system-prompt leakage, SSRF and excessive agency — measured 9d ago.
A static scan of the body, not an audit. Every finding is printed with the line that produced it so you can judge whether it matters here. A mod is markdown that instructs an agent; that is exactly why what it instructs is worth reading.
Nothing flagged
None of the 26 patterns this scan looks for appear in this file: no shell pipes, no recursive deletes, no credential paths, no hidden text, no instruction-override or anti-refusal phrasing, no agent-config snooping. That is not a guarantee, it is the absence of the things that are checkable.

ag-implementar-codigo — Construir Codigo
Persona
Pense como um dev pragmatico que entrega codigo que funciona, nao codigo perfeito. Voce segue o plano, mas adapta quando a realidade do codigo diverge da teoria da SPEC. Commits frequentes, testes junto com o codigo, e zero abstractions especulativas. Seu criterio: "se eu sair de ferias amanha, outro dev consegue continuar daqui?"
Spawn the ag-implementar-codigo agent to implement code following a task plan.
Invocation
Use the Agent tool with:
subagent_type:ag-implementar-codigomode:bypassPermissionsrun_in_background:trueprompt: Compose from template below + $ARGUMENTS
Dynamic Context
- Branch: !
git branch --show-current 2>/dev/null || echo "no-git" - Task plan: !
cat task_plan.md 2>/dev/null | head -30 || echo "none"
Prompt Template
Projeto: [CWD or user-provided path]
Branch: [from dynamic context]
Scope: [modules/scope from $ARGUMENTS]
Implementar seguindo task_plan.md:
- Re-ler plano a cada 10 acoes
- Commit incremental a cada 5 acoes
- Durante build: usar LSP tool (hover/documentSymbol) para validar tipos dos arquivos modificados (instantaneo, sem custo de memoria)
- Self-check FINAL (tsc full + lint + test) apenas antes de declarar pronto
- Para 3+ modulos independentes, usar Agent Teams (parallel build)
Worktree isolation ativo. Codigo que funciona > codigo perfeito.
Important
- ALWAYS spawn as Agent subagent — do NOT execute inline
- After spawning, confirm to the user that the build agent is running
- Supports parallel build via Agent Teams for 3+ independent modules
- Uses worktree isolation for safe implementation
Output
- Codigo funcional implementando todos os itens do task_plan.md
- Commits incrementais (1 a cada 5 arquivos modificados)
- session-state.json atualizado com progresso
- Handoff para ag-validar-execucao apos self-check passar
Anti-Patterns
- NUNCA implementar sem ler o plano primeiro — task_plan.md e vinculante
- NUNCA acumular 10+ arquivos sem commit — context reset perde trabalho nao salvo
- NUNCA ignorar erros de typecheck para "avancar" — debt tecnico retorna multiplicado
- NUNCA deixar TODOs/stubs e marcar como done — "parcial" nao e "done"
- NUNCA refatorar ou otimizar durante build — agentes especializados existem (ag-refatorar-codigo, ag-otimizar-codigo)
